Homeowners may achieve additional discounts when they buy buildings and home contents insurance together from the same supplier. Some insurers offer very good discounts to new policyholders that buy combined policies. So if you are thinking of buying both buildings and contents insurance, make sure you try and opt for a provider that is currently offering some kind of discount when you buy both policies together.
Policy voluntary excess is something that homeowners might want to look at in more detail. It is a well known fact that by increasing the payment charges on voluntary excess contributions, that it will reduce the costs. This is because policyholders will be paying out more in the case of a claim, so the annual premium can be reduced.
Homeowners that have a burglar alarm can also achieve additional discounts from the insurer. Policyholders that have a security alarm are less likely to make a claim for a burglary, and are therefore given an additional discount from the insurer. Before you get a house insurance quote make sure you have one fitted so you can get another saving.
